Cyrus, God's Instrument
45 Thus says the Lord to (A)his anointed, to Cyrus,
(B)whose right hand I have grasped,
to subdue nations before him
and (C)to loose the belts of kings,
to open doors before him
that gates may not be closed:

Isaiah 45:2-6
English Standard Version
2 “I will go before you
and (A)level the exalted places,[a]
(B)I will break in pieces the doors of bronze
and cut through the bars of iron,
3 (C)I will give you the treasures of darkness
and the hoards in secret places,
that you may know that it is I, the Lord,
the God of Israel, (D)who call you by your name.
4 For the sake of my servant Jacob,
and Israel my chosen,
(E)I call you by your name,
(F)I name you, though you do not know me.
5 (G)I am the Lord, and there is no other,
besides me there is no God;
(H)I equip you, though you do not know me,
6 (I)that people may know, from the rising of the sun
and from the west, that there is none besides me;
I am the Lord, and there is no other.
Footnotes
- Isaiah 45:2 Masoretic Text; Dead Sea Scroll, Septuagint level the mountains

Isaiah 45:2-6
King James Version
2 I will go before thee, and make the crooked places straight: I will break in pieces the gates of brass, and cut in sunder the bars of iron:
3 And I will give thee the treasures of darkness, and hidden riches of secret places, that thou mayest know that I, the Lord, which call thee by thy name, am the God of Israel.
4 For Jacob my servant's sake, and Israel mine elect, I have even called thee by thy name: I have surnamed thee, though thou hast not known me.
5 I am the Lord, and there is none else, there is no God beside me: I girded thee, though thou hast not known me:
6 That they may know from the rising of the sun, and from the west, that there is none beside me. I am the Lord, and there is none else.
